The Need for Mobile Incinerators in Remote Camps
Remote camps, such as those used for military, oil field, or construction operations, often face significant challenges in managing waste. The lack of access to traditional waste management infrastructure, combined with the need to maintain a clean and healthy environment, makes mobile incinerators an attractive solution. Mobile incinerators can be easily transported to remote locations and can be used to dispose of a variety of waste types, including medical waste, animal waste, and solid waste.

Fuel Type and Burning Rate
Mobile incinerators offered by Hiclover can operate on different fuel types, including diesel, natural gas, and LPG. The burning rate can be adjusted to accommodate different waste types and quantities, ranging from 5kgs to 1000kgs per hour.
Chamber Size and Smoke Scrubber
The chamber size of mobile incinerators can vary from 100Liters to 6000Liters, depending on the specific requirements of the remote camp. Additionally, Hiclover offers dry scrubber and wet scrubber options for effective smoke management and emission control.
